Fascia Painting in Boulder, CO
Fascia painting services focus on refreshing and protecting the horizontal boards that run along the edges of a roof, commonly known as the fascia. This service is often requested during home exterior updates or repairs, especially when the fascia has become weathered, faded, or shows signs of peeling paint. Projects can include painting or repainting existing fascia, as well as preparing surfaces through cleaning or minor repairs to ensure a smooth, long-lasting finish.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the type of paint used, and how the project can help improve curb appeal and protect the home from weather-related damage.
Before requesting fascia painting, homeowners should consider the current condition of their fascia boards, including whether they require repairs or surface preparation. It’s also helpful to know the type of paint suitable for exterior use and the expected lifespan of the finish. Clarifying whether the project includes cleaning, sanding, or minor repairs can ensure expectations are aligned. Proper preparation and quality materials are essential for achieving a durable, attractive finish that enhances the appearance and longevity of the home’s exterior.

Fascia Painting Questions
What is fascia painting? Fascia painting involves applying protective and decorative paint to the horizontal boards along the roofline of a property, enhancing appearance and preventing weather damage.
When should fascia be painted? Fascia should be painted when it shows signs of peeling, cracking, or fading to maintain its protective properties and appearance.
What types of properties typically need fascia painting? Both residential homes and commercial buildings with visible roofline boards can benefit from fascia painting to improve curb appeal and durability.
What should property owners consider before painting fascia? It's important to inspect for any damage or rot beforehand, and choose high-quality, weather-resistant paint suitable for exterior wood surfaces.
